Who should be careful?

While eggs are generally safe and healthy, some people may need to limit their consumption:

People with heart disease or genetic cholesterol problems.

People with egg allergies.

Anyone who follows a low cholesterol diet recommended by a doctor.

Summary:

Eggs have significantly changed their bad reputation. For most healthy adults, eating one to two eggs a day can be part of a nutritious, balanced diet. They provide high-quality protein, key nutrients, and a range of health benefits.

As with any food, moderation is key. To maximize the benefits, pair eggs with fiber-rich vegetables, whole grains, and healthy fats.
